NAME
Syntax::Highlight::Engine::Kate::Clipper - a Plugin for Clipper syntax highlighting
SYNOPSIS
require Syntax::Highlight::Engine::Kate::Clipper; my $sh = new Syntax::Highlight::Engine::Kate::Clipper([ ]);
DESCRIPTION
Syntax::Highlight::Engine::Kate::Clipper is a plugin module that provides syntax highlighting for Clipper to the Syntax::Haghlight::Engine::Kate highlighting engine. This code is generated from the syntax definition files used by the Kate project. It works quite fine, but can use refinement and optimization. It inherits Syntax::Higlight::Engine::Kate::Template. See also there.
